Not sure... but Dragonwave's PoE is not "standard" PoE... you have to purchase their expensive, proprietary cables with the radios... so if you are running a new cable, why not just run LMR400 and not ever have to worry about it again?

Honestly I was a little disappointed with the pricing... I thought it would be more aggressive from the newest player on the block. For the 100Mbps full-duplex version, it was only about 25% less than a similar Dragonwave setup. I guess I was hoping for more like 50% less. :) Travis

That statement, really depends on the price that is relased, and the volume the buyer is considering, as well as their time
frame.
                If someone is planning on dropping 1/4-1/2 million on
Licensed gear in a year, and the price is really good, allowing the
provider to get
                30% more links up for the same dollar, its not much of a
risk being the first, considering the future potential reward. If the WISP's timeline is also spread out over the year, they have plenty of time to wait for bug fixes, before the bulk of the deployments. The golden question right now is, what price is Trango going to be at? The prospective buyers are predicting a low cost entry point, just because Trango has Always delivered industry leading price point, to jump start volume adoption in the industry. However,
prior to seeing
                the price released, I'll say Dragon wave has the upper
hand, for potentially being able to be the price leader based on their all outdoor design, compared to Trango's half and half
indoor/outdoor.
